ESTERO, Fla. (Sept. 30, 2025) — West Bay Club will host the second annual West Bay Collegiate Invitational Golf Tournament from October 5–7, 2025. This highly anticipated event will feature 12 NCAA Division I men’s golf teams, most of which are ranked among the nation’s Top 100 programs.

Competing teams include the Florida Gulf Coast University Eagles, University of Central Florida Knights, Stetson Hatters, University of Texas El Paso Miners, Eastern Michigan Eagles, DePaul Blue Devils, Middle Tennessee Blue Raiders, Florida Atlantic University Owls, George Mason Patriots, Jacksonville University Dolphins, Coastal Carolina Chanticleers, and Elon Phoenix.

The tournament kicks off with a Collegiate/Amateur Day on October 5, followed by two days of tournament play October 6–7, concluding with a luncheon and awards ceremony at West Bay Club.

Morgan Stanley is the presenting sponsor for the 2025 Invitational, underscoring the tournament’s growing prominence in collegiate golf.

The event was organized by West Bay Club’s Head Golf Professional, Danny Butts, who also serves as President of the South Florida PGA Southwest Chapter.

“We’re honored to welcome some of the country’s most competitive programs to West Bay Club,” said Danny Butts. “The Invitational is about more than golf — it’s about building connections, showcasing collegiate talent, and celebrating the role our community plays in growing the game. We’re proud to host an event that brings national attention to West Bay and inspires the next generation of players.”

About West Bay Club
West Bay Club is a member-owned private club and gated community in Estero, Florida, spanning nearly 900 acres with more than half dedicated to conservation. Following a recent $40 million renovation, West Bay offers a championship Pete and P.B. Dye–designed, Fry-Straka–renovated golf course, a private Beach Club on the Gulf of America, and multiple dining venues. Amenities include a resort-style pool and fitness center, spa, tennis, pickleball, bocce, and the River Park with boating, kayaking, and fishing. With a blend of estate homes, villas, and high-rise residences, West Bay provides an exceptional lifestyle that combines world-class recreation, natural beauty, and a strong sense of community.

About Troon
Headquartered in Scottsdale, Ariz., Troon is the world’s largest golf and golf-related hospitality management company providing services at 940-plus locations in 45-plus states and 40-plus countries, including operational responsibility for 575-plus 18-hole equivalent golf courses. In addition to golf, Troon specializes in homeowner association management, private residence clubs, estate management and associated hospitality venues. Troon’s award-winning food and beverage division operates and manages 600-plus food and beverage operations located at golf resorts, private clubs, daily fee golf courses and recreational facilities. Troon’s family of brands includes Troon Golf, Troon Privé, Troon International, Indigo Sports, CADDIEMASTER, ClubUp, Cliff Drysdale Tennis, True Club Solutions, RealFood Hospitality, Strategy & Design and RF DesignStudio, ICON Management and Eventive Sports.
